Planting Calendar for Scabiosa

Frost tolerance for scabiosa: Tolerant of some frost.
When to plant: Up to 5 weeks before last frost.

Since scabiosa are one of those plants that can tolerate a little bit of cold weather you can plant them a bit earlier in the year than other frost tender plants.

The earliest that you can plant scabiosa in Island Park is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ant scabiosa and expect a good harvest is probably September. If you wait any later than that and your scabiosa may not have a chance to fully mature. Starting your scabiosa indoors is a great way to get them started a few weeks earlier.

Last Frost Date

In Island Park the average date of last frost happens on April 15. In the coldest months of winter you should expect an average low temperature of 5°F.

Remember that USDA zone info for Island Park is an average and the actual date of last frost changes from year to year. Half of the time in Island Park you get a frost after April 15 so be sure to be ready to protect your scabiosa in the event of a surprise late frost.
